Two wards at Raigmore Hospital remain closed despite a beds crisis that forced the cancellation of some operations easing late last week.
A spokesperson for NHS Highland said today that wards 6C and 3A remain closed though ward 4C has reopened.
A total of 15 operations were cancelled at the hospital last Tuesday but the spokesperson said that selective operations are currently going ahead as planned.
The cancellations were caused after a "significant" rise in the number of trauma cases admitted to the hospital, and not enough existing patients being able to be discharged to free up capacity, the delay caused in part by outbreaks of Covid-19 and scabies.
